Emergency Services Skills Assessment
The Emergency Services Skills Assessment (ESSA) is a practical, assessment-only evaluation designed to benchmark emergency response capabilities against industry-defined standards. Endorsed by EMCoP (Emergency Management Community of Practice), ESSA ensures a consistent, portable, and industry-recognised measure of operational readiness for personnel operating in high-risk environments.
Underground Firefighting Cluster
The purpose of this course is to provide course participants with the necessary skills for controlling fires in underground metalliferous mines. Elements and performance criteria include assessing the situation and preparing for fire control operations; controlling the fire; and restoring and refurbishing fire equipment to operational condition.
